How does Civil 3D modelling help with NEMA and WRA approvals?
Our Civil 3D models generate precise grading plans, drainage layouts, and earthwork calculations required for NEMA (National Environment Management Authority) environmental impact assessments. For water-related projects, we produce detailed network designs and hydraulic analysis reports that meet WRA (Water Resources Authority) submission standards, significantly reducing approval timelines.

Can Civil 3D models integrate with other engineering software?
Cadreatech’s Civil 3D workflows integrate seamlessly with AutoCAD, Revit for structural coordination, GIS systems for spatial analysis, hydraulic modelling software like SewerGEMS and WaterCAD, and project management platforms. We export models in multiple formats (DWG, DXF, IFC, LandXML) ensuring compatibility with contractor systems and facilitating BIM (Building Information Modelling) collaboration on complex projects.

How long does Civil 3D modelling take for typical projects?
Timelines vary by project complexity. A residential subdivision (5-10 hectares) typically requires 1-2 weeks. Road corridor designs (5-10 km) take 2-4 weeks depending on terrain complexity. Large mixed-use developments may require 4-8 weeks. Water and Wastewater Infrastructure Modelling
Water supply network design requires specialized Civil 3D modelling that Cadreatech provides for both municipal water systems and private developments. Our models incorporate hydraulic analysis, pressure zone optimization, pipe sizing calculations, and pump station layouts that meet WRA design standards and Nairobi City Water specifications.
We model sewer collection systems, wastewater treatment facilities, and sewage pumping stations with accurate invert elevations, hydraulic gradient analysis, and manhole spacing compliant with Kenyan sanitation guidelines. Our stormwater drainage designs include catchment analysis, culvert sizing, detention basin modelling, and outfall designs required for NEMA environmental approvals.
